The atomic weight of helium is 4 times of hydrogen. Its rate of diffusion as compared to hydrogen is

(a) twice

(b) \(\frac 1 {\sqrt 2}\) times

(c) \(\sqrt 2\) times

(d) \(\frac 14\)th

Correct option is (b) \(\frac 1 {\sqrt 2}\)

\(\frac {r_{He}}{r_{H_2}} = \sqrt {\frac 24}= \frac1{\sqrt 2}\)
